Saskatchewan Wildfire Update – July 15 July 15, 2025 As of 11:00 am on Tuesday, July 15, there are 50 active wildfires in Saskatchewan. Of those active fires, four are categorized as contained, 12 are not contained, 18 are ongoing assessment and 16 are listed as protecting values.   Read full details here: https://www.saskatchewan.ca/government/news-and-media/2025/july/15/saskatchewan-wildfire-update-july-15 Back

Saskatchewan Wildfire Update – July 14 July 14, 2025 As of 11:00 am on Monday, July 14, there are 55 active wildfires in Saskatchewan. Of those active fires, four are categorized as contained, 12 are not contained, 21 are ongoing assessment and 18 are listed as protecting values.    Read full details here: https://www.saskatchewan.ca/government/news-and-media/2025/july/14/saskatchewan-wildfire-update-july-14 Back
